Dangerous Rhetoric 122: Tara Faul & Chelly Bouferrache

For Episode 122, we were joined by Tara Faul and Chelly Bouferrache to discuss the situation on the ground in Portland, Oregon, which they have been documenting for many years as native Oregonians. We discussed their experiences as independent journalists and photographers, including facing threats and being assaulted for holding conservative viewpoints; the political climate; radical activists and criminals; widespread graffiti and human excrement; as well as the homelessness and drug addiction situation, specifically fentanyl.
